Tax department director Juan Hernandez has told a Santiago audience that the tax authorities would facilitate the paperwork to help free trade zone companies to purchase items needed for their businesses on the local market without having to pay ITBIS, the value-added tax. The special identification cards would ease the process for the free zone companies. Speaking at the workshop held yesterday on the subject of "Fiscal Receipt Number" and sponsored by the Dominican Free Zones Association (ADOZONA) and the National Free Zones Council (CNZF), Hernandez said that his staff had met with free zone representatives on four occasions in order to contribute to the recovery process. As a result, free zone companies should expect to encounter less paperwork when renewing permits for purchases on the local market. ADOZONA president Fernando Capellan and Santiago Free Zone Association president Aquiles Bermudez both reacted positively to the announcement.
